Uflex To Invest Rs 1,700 Crore In Uttar Pradesh Manufacturing Unit

Packaging solutions firm Uflex is up on the toes to enhance its manufacturing capacity investing Rs 1,700 crore in the project. The company also aims to set up a solar project in Uttar Pradesh.

 Ashok Chaturvedi, Chairman & Managing Director, Uflex, said ahead of the Uttar Pradesh Investors' Summit 2018 said, "We have ambitious plans to substantially enhance our manufacturing capacity for flexible packaging in the next few years. For this ... we endeavour to invest Rs 500 crore towards the project," Chaturvedi said the company also plans to invest Rs 1,200 crore to set up a solar project.

He added, "As a Group we lay a lot of emphasis on environmental sustainability in all our business processes, therefore, we proposed to set up a solar project on 300 acres of land with an investment of approximately Rs 1,200 crore. Thus, electricity produced will be used for captive consumption and the surplus shall be supplied to state or national grid.”

Uttar Pradesh Investors' Summit is scheduled to be held on February 21-22, 2018 in Lucknow

The project also has the employment generation capacity and could engage 750 people at various levels.

Uflex which has its headquarters in Noida, has also set up manufacturing facilities in India, the UAE, Mexico, Poland, Egypt and the US.
